WebDr.DSK III CSE-- DAA UNIT-V Dynamic Programming Page 2 General Characteristics of Dynamic Programming: The general characteristics of Dynamic programming are 1) The problem can be divided into stages with a policy decision required at each stage. 2) Each stage has number of states associated with it. WebDynamic Programming requires: 1. Problem divided into overlapping sub-problems 2. Sub-problem can be represented by a table 3. Principle of optimality, recursive relation …

The idea: Compute thesolutionsto thesubsub-problems once and store the solutions in a table, so that they can be reused (repeatedly) later. Remark: We trade space for time. 3 china claytonWeb3.
